Do you guys ever have good/long overnights in interesting places where you can actually enjoy yourself? Is it mostly short overnights in hotels near the airport next to a highway?
Unless you get the long, which are kinda hard to come by, a good portion of our overnights suck location wise. A lot like what you said, hotels in business parks, middle of no where near the airport etc. some of the new overnights coming out of Atlanta are not bad. But overall the hotel language in the contract needs a compete overhaul. 200 overnights are usually on the shorter side, like 11-13 hours and 900 is more like 13-15. Not uncommon to get 17-19. Cant speak for like holders how much they get he long stay which is 20+.
Biggest issue is the FA always seem to get a big say in where we stay or move to. And their opinion is basically a 2 minute van ride and microwaves in the room and a Waffle House to walk to. Where as most of the pilots wouldn’t mind a 10-15 minute ride where there is things to do or eat at. We do have some pretty good overnights though. JAX ans AGS come to mind. Others aren’t bad.
